Foot Wear and Rain Gear. Where an employee works outside and requires rain gear, and/or is required to wear safety footwear which must comply with WorkSafe BC regulations, the Employer shall provide each year to regular, full-time employees, or casual employees after the completion of 1000 hours of work each year, fifty percent (50%) of the cost of purchase of rain gear, and/or purchase or repair of safety shoes. The Employer's share for either or both items shall be a maximum of two hundred ($200.00) per annum, per such employee, payable only upon submission of a receipt or receipts by such employee.
